    Excellent staff at the Kapolei Social Security office!…read more Every representative I've interacted with has been courteous, patient, and genuinely helpful. I've been working on handling my dad's account for quite some time now, and all three of my visits have gone smoothly. Each visit helped me better understand the process, and although the wait can be long for walk-ins, I'm grateful to have been able to get everything taken care of efficiently. When you arrive, security assists you with either the mobile check-in or entering your SSN into their system. After receiving your ticket number, you simply wait to be called. There's also a screen displaying the numbers currently being assisted. Restrooms are conveniently located nearby, and the air conditioning keeps the waiting area comfortable. I've walked in twice - the first wait was about 30 minutes, and the second was 1 hr and 40 mins. The one time I made an appointment, I was shocked when they called my number right on time! :) From my experience, those needing answers to general questions or assistance with small stuff may be helped sooner than visitors requiring account changes. Yesterday, I went to update the bank account number for direct deposit and was told I needed to go back in line since I was a walk-in. Thankfully, I was still helped as soon as a space cleared between appointment times. This was the long wait lol Overall, this is the office I'd return to whenever I need assistance with Social Security matters. Parking is plentiful, and I truly appreciate the staff's willingness to help. They seem to understand that dealing with Social Security can sometimes be stressful, and their professionalism makes the experience so much easier.

    I received a notice that my driver's license was going to expire in 6 months, so I went to the…read moreAloha Q website to make an appointment. The closest satellite city hall to me had an appointment available in 4 months, so I opted for Pearlridge which was only a 2 month wait. I arrived at the mall a few minutes early and parked by Ross wanting to walk through the store to get into the mall. However, Ross wasn't open until 9am, so I waited there. When they opened, the worker let everyone know that the inside gate to the mall wouldn't be open because the mall didn't open until 10am. I thought that was strange so I checked my appointment time and verified that it was before 10am. I went to a different entrance and there was a line of people waiting too. Luckily, someone came out of the mall and someone else grabbed the door before it shut and everyone walked in and headed up to the satellite city hall. When I got to the entrance, the worker asked me if I had an appointment. I confirmed it with the info on my phone. Then she asked me if I filled out the paper application and brought it with me. I didn't know about that so she hands me a clipboard and I fill it out before heading up to the window. At least a half dozen other people behind me also did not fill out the application either. Everything else went smoothly and quickly, so yay. I asked the worker at the window how I was supposed to get in if the mall didn't open until 10am. She said I was supposed to go to the door by the monorail on the Macy's side of the mall. After hearing and experiencing all of this, I went back on the Aloha Q website to see how I missed all this information. The appointment before mall hours info was indeed there, but only a short blurb BEFORE you start getting into the appointment process. Also, I didn't go through the entire process to see where they were supposed to tell me to fill out the paper application beforehand. I do believe that the all the necessary information is there, BUT, due to the large amount of people that I saw making the same mistakes that I did, plus some reviews I've read on Yelp after the fact, I think the City needs to think of different ways to get this information across to people. I'm not sure if there was some glitch in the system when I made my appointment, but I received no email confirmation or instructions. Luckily, I had made a screenshot of my appointment date and time so I knew when to go. That, coupled with the fact that my appointment was made 2 months prior, and there was no way I'd remember anything anyways with no email confirmation close to my appointment date. Anyways, TLDR: Special entrance by monorail for appointments before 10am. Fill out your application ahead of time for driver's license renewals. Otherwise, pretty good service.
